How Do I Get a Second Extension on Taxes Beyond Six Months?
If the automatic six-month extension is still not enough time for you to file, how many tax extensions can you file? You can request an additional extension of time to file taxes beyond the six-month period, but you cannot ask for multiple tax extensions. To do so, you’ll need to include a letter explaining why you’re in need of an additional tax extension. Mail your letter to the address found on Form 4868 under the heading “Where to File”.
If the IRS doesn’t receive Form 4868 first, it will approve your request for an additional tax extension only in cases of undue hardship. If the IRS doesn’t approve your request, you’ll still have to file your return. That said, it’s a smart idea to submit your request early to allow yourself enough time to do so.
